Cargo Shift

When the cargo of a truck shifts during transport, it can be difficult to control. This can cause the driver to lose control of the vehicle and could cause an accident.

Most accidents that occur during cargo shifts happen when the cargo is not properly secured or loaded. When the cargo shifts, the truck's centre of gravity shifts. This makes it more likely to be rolled over or hit by another vehicle.

The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ration has developed a set of strict standards to be followed when loading trucks. If the cargo of a vehicle does not meet these standards, the trucking or shipping company that loaded the cargo could be held responsible for any injuries or damages suffered in an accident.

Both truck drivers and shippers who employ them have an significant roles to play in loading cargo. Both parties should have the knowledge and training to recognize when a cargo isn't secure or properly loaded.

If the driver of the truck brakes abruptly, turns too fast or takes a bend too fast, the improperly loaded cargo could shift. It may also shift if the driver is speeding or driving on rough roads.

A trucking collision caused by a cargo shifting could have devastating consequences. If the truck flips or jackknifes it can cause serious injuries or even death.

Vehicle Defect

As opposed to cars for passengers, trucks are complex vehicles that require a large amount of maintenance and inspections in order to ensure their safety on the road. Unfortunately, profit-driven trucking companies often try to reduce the frequency of these inspections and repairs, leading to defective vehicle components that can contribute to deadly accidents.

If a defect in the vehicle or one of its parts caused your accident, you may be in a position to hold the responsible party accountable for your losses. An experienced attorney will help you develop an effective case built on your specific accident situation.

Product liability claims arising from an accident involving trucks typically involve design defects, manufacturing defects, and marketing issues. A design defect indicates that an organization designed a product in a manner that was extremely dangerous, regardless of how it was constructed or assembled. A manufacturing defect is when a product isn't made or installed correctly.

A marketing defect however it occurs when a firm does not warn consumers about the dangers of the product or make false claims about safety. For instance in the event that a car's roofing collapses during a rollover, it may be a marketing defect if a manufacturer did not warn that this could happen.
